What the Data Says About Kareem
The Social Security Administration has registered 17,776 babies named Kareem between 1964 and 2024, spanning 61 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a boy's name, Kareem currently holds the #675 rank among boys for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 1980, when 459 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Kareem performed strongest in the 2010s, accumulating 3,381 births during that ten-year window. Across the 7 decades of recorded activity, Kareem shows notable generational variation in parental adoption.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in New York, which accounts for 3,577 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Pennsylvania and California. In total, SSA state-level files list Kareem in 35 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.
No etymological entry is currently available for Kareem in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 17,776 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
